the marine-life store would like to set up fish tanks that contain equal numbers of angel fish, swordtails, and guppies. what is

the greatest number of tanks that can be set up if the store has 12 angel fish, 24 swordfish, and 30 guppies?

Answer:  6

Step-by-step explanation:

Given : The marine-life store would like to set up fish tanks that contain equal numbers of angel fish, swordtails, and guppies.

The store has 12 angel fish, 24 swordfish, and 30 guppies.

Then, the greatest number of tanks that can be set up will be the greatest common factor of 12, 24 and 30.

Prime factorization of 12, 24 and 30 :

12=2\times2\times3\\\\24=2\times2\times2\times3\\\\30=2\times3\times5

Then, Greatest common factor of 12, 24 and 30=2\times3=6

Hence, the greatest number of tanks that can be set up will be 6.
